Output 1e6476589adb974581b39e81165abafab934bae99859e2aceeefe9ca69b627cb:5

value
521376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8172d44bce5783518b2bc3d7cfc9950be29d2b14 OP_EQUAL
address
3DVUemWd7Z7xYVjB9MYHo1CgTJTwjh3Lok
transaction
1e6476589adb974581b39e81165abafab934bae99859e2aceeefe9ca69b627cb
confirmations
127443
spent
true